UnivaBio is a global student competition open to students aged 13+, hosted collaboratively by BioCataalysis and UnivaDev. The event supports innovation at the intersection of healthcare and technology.
Theme: Artificial Intelligence for Human Health
This event brings together young innovators from around the world to explore AI technology's role in human health. Working individually or in teams, participants will design and build a meaningful technical product that helps people detect illness earlier, understand it better, or live with it more easily.
Your project can take almost any form: an app, a website, a simulation, a system, or an algorithm. Examples include an AI EdTech app teaching about specific health concepts, a classification model trained on imaging datasets, or an innovation with significant medical implications.
Participants are encouraged to use AI assistants while building. The goal is to keep the technical barrier low enough that beginners with ambitious ideas can ship them. What matters most is that you understand what you built and can explain it; be prepared to walk judges through your own code.
Submission Requirements - Project: A website, app, or other coding prototypes with user interaction capabilities. - Demo Video: A video explaining the project's purpose, showcasing features, and demonstrating user interaction. - One Page Project Description: A PDF describing the project purpose and key features. - Code Documentation: A PDF document showcasing all code developed towards the creation of the project (or a GitHub repository).
